Handover note — Crumbwheel order cutoffs.

Welcome aboard. The bakery cutoff rule in Crumbwheel closes same-day orders at 14:00 local to each storefront, not UTC — this has bitten us twice. Holiday overrides live in the calendar service and take precedence silently, so always check there first when a cutoff looks wrong. To unlock the calendar service's admin console after a restart, enter the recovery passphrase below.

vault phrase of bagap-bahaf = silion-pelox-sorox-casdor-quenwyn-fraax-eliox-praael-kelion-quenvan-kasox-rusael-norius-belvan

## CSV Import Wizard — plugin runbook

Plugins for the Tallygrove import wizard run in a sandbox; declare column mappers in manifest.yaml. Failures over 2% abort the batch. Test against the staging ledger only. The staging ledger authenticates every plugin callback, so the shared callback secret must be exported in your env file, starting with the line directly below.

env line for fafof-fahag: LEDGER_TOKEN5=f8790

This page summarises the launch plan for Larkspur Atlas, restricted to heads of department. The phased rollout begins with internal dogfooding, followed by a limited release to partners in the Dunmorrow corridor, then general availability six weeks later. Engineering readiness is tracked by Selwyn Park; marketing assets are in final review under Ines Caldera. Pricing and positioning remain embargoed until the partner briefing. Do not circulate beyond this group. The confidential business note appears below.

internal memo for hafog-hadug: The pricing group signed off on a budget of $16.1 million for Project Gorir. The renewal with Oliionax Systems closes at $14.1 million a year, 46 percent above the last contract.